This article dives deep into what RapidLeech v2 rev43 is, its core features, how to install it, security considerations, and why it still matters in 2025. RapidLeech v2 rev43 is a specific revision (build 43) of the second major version of the RapidLeech script. Unlike its predecessor (v1), v2 introduced a plugin-based architecture, better error handling, and support for multihost APIs. Rev43, in particular, fixed several critical bugs related to file chunking, SSL certificate verification, and server load optimization. rapidleech v2 rev43

If you need a lightweight, PHP-based leeching script that runs on cheap shared hosting (with PHP 7.4) and you are comfortable tweaking plugins, rev43 is a reliable workhorse. Thousands of private leech sites still run this exact revision because it is stable, well-documented, and easy to modify.

rev43 is legacy software, but it remains incredibly effective for file hosts that haven’t changed their API since 2018. For modern hosts (Hexupload, KrakenFiles), you will need to write custom plugins or switch to a newer fork like RapidLeech v3 or XFileSharing .
